Veterinarian here. Can't give any specific advice as I have never seen your dog. Generally speaking though, I anesthetize old dogs all the time. Your veterinarian would be unlikely to recommend the surgery if they didn't think your pet could make it through it. However, even on the youngest most healthy patients there are inherent risks of anesthesia, and many of these do increase with age. Overall, it's a tough decision. Your dog will likely get some level of relief afterwards assuming everything goes well, but it is an intensive surgery with a long recovery. The question is whether or not additional pain meds could provide relief without being such a drastic option. Good luck with your decision and thanks for caring so much about your friend
